1. A Robot in the Orange Orchard

Lu Sen is a man who works as the chairman of a successful technology company but often finds himself in large group settings.

While he has no problem speaking to a number of people, he has tremendous difficulty with any kind of direct physical contact.

He suffers from a strange allergy that is only triggered by direct skin-to-skin contact, something as simple as a handshake can prove deadly for him.

With no ability to make direct contact with others, Lu Sen is intrigued to learn that a doctor named Fu Yang has created a very lifelike robotic companion nicknamed “Friday”.

Willing to invest further in Dr. Fu Yang, Lu Sen had Friday delivered to his house so he could test the full capabilities of this magnificent creation. Despite agreeing to Lu Sen’s request, the doctor is embarrassed when a last-minute technical problem renders his robot useless.

Unable to bear the thought of losing her credibility and funding, she enlists her former assistant, Yang Shan Shan, to replace the robot, just long enough for her to get up and running again.

Being a real-life model for robotic appearances, Shan Shan is identical to robots in every way and only agrees to the doctor’s request when she realizes that she really has no other choice. Arriving at Lu Sen’s house on “Friday”, Shan Shan does her best to imitate the robot’s behavior.

This Chinese drama with the male lead Rare Allergy was released in 2022 with 30 episodes. You can watch it on Viki.

4. Miss Crow with Mr. Lizard

Gu Chuan is a passionate and passionate young man his whole life until his life is turned upside down due to a sudden traffic accident.

He suffered a life-threatening wound to his heart and surgeons were able to save him by giving him an emergency heart transplant.

But when he recovered, he found that he was no longer allowed to do most forms of exercise. Even worse, the doctors warned him that experiencing strong emotions could also end his life prematurely.

He tries to return to a normal life, but the changes he has to make to his lifestyle take away all of his existence. He carefully avoided anything that might increase his heart rate even if it turned him into a shadow of his former self.

However, things took another turn, when a woman named Jiang Xiao Ning came to work at the company that she and her friends founded.

This is one of the best dramas with sick male lead was released in 2021. It has 36 episodes and is available on WeTV.
